Inventory Optimization: The Key to Profitability

In today's competitive business landscape, efficiently managing inventory is crucial for achieving profitability. Overstocked inventory ties up valuable capital and increases storage costs, while low inventory can lead to lost sales and frustrated customers.

A robust inventory optimization strategy involves a combination of advanced tools and techniques that allow businesses to perfectly forecast demand, reduce waste, and utilize resources.

  • Adopting data-driven forecasting methods can help businesses predict future demand with greater precision.
  • Continuously analyzing sales trends and customer behavior provides valuable insights into product demand patterns.
  • Streamlining the supply chain can reduce lead times and increase inventory turnover rates.

Managing Inventory : Lowering Costs, Increasing Revenue

Effective inventory control is essential for any business that wants to succeed. By optimizing your inventory management processes, you can significantly lower costs and maximize revenue. Dilligent planning and execution are crucial to achieving these goals.

One of the key benefits of effective inventory control is cost reduction. By monitoring your inventory levels precisely, you can avoid stockouts and overstocking, both of which can lead unnecessary expenses. Additionally, efficient inventory management allows better negotiation with suppliers, leading to lower purchasing costs.

On the revenue side, effective inventory control helps sales by ensuring that products are in stock when customers demand them. This boosts customer satisfaction and loyalty, which can lead to increased sales and profitability.

  • Utilize a robust inventory management system that records all aspects of your inventory lifecycle.
  • Forecast demand accurately to prevent stockouts and overstocking.
  • Review your inventory data regularly to identify trends and opportunities for improvement.
